Two Berlin pitchers handcuff Avon in Section II softball

Lena Stortz and the Avon Little League softball team dropped a 3-1 decision to Berlin on Monday in Section II action.
BRISTOL, July 8, 2024 – Two Berlin Little League softball pitchers combined to allow just two hits and strike out eight to lead Berlin to a 3-1 win over Avon in a Section II Major Division (ages 11-12) state tournament game Monday night at Rockwell Park.
Berlin’s Callie Szymanski and Alexis Gorneault each pitched three hits. Each gave up a hit and each pitcher struck out four.
Berlin (5-0, 1-0 Section II ) and Shelton (0-1 Section II) face each other on Tuesday night. The top two teams in Section II will play a one-game championship game on Wednesday night for the right to advance to the Final Four of the state tournament.
Avon (4-1, 1-1 Section II) trailed 3-0 before they pushed a run across in the fourth inning. Jackie Funderburk led off the inning with a walk and moved to second base on a ground ball out. Funderburk scored on Lena Stortz’s RBI single to center field.
Berlin took a 2-0 lead in the first inning thanks to a double from Szymanski, a single from Harper Amos and a two-out error by Avon that allowed both runs to score.
Berlin extended their lead to 3-0 in the third inning with another unearned run. Ella Rose Lenois reached on an error and moved to second base on the poor throw. Lenois moved to third base on a bunt single and scored on an fielder’s choice.
Storz allowed five hits and struck out four.
